Log:
On the 'move-tracking-2' branch: Change the branch id format to
always include a leading zero component, in preparation for
implementing top-level branching.

* subversion/libsvn_delta/branch.c
  (assert_branch_state_invariants): Expect the 'outer_eid' field to be
    a non-negative id, even in a top-level branch.
  (branch_id_split): New, extracted from svn_branch_state_parse.
    Don't treat a single-component branch id specially.
  (svn_branch_state_parse): Use it.
  (svn_branch_get_id): Don't omit the top-level component id, even
    though it is currently always zero.
